Band: Michael Katon
Title: MK
Label: Provogue Records

This is the third guitar album I’ve reviewed this month from those chaps at Provogue Records and I must say is the best of the three.  Not that the other two were bad, far from it, but this album is really something special.

Michael Katon’s boogie blues rock is just magnificent on this new release.  The opening track ‘Back to your Cages’ is just superb and will have your feet tapping from the first few chords to the last.  The song sets you up perfectly for the rest of the album.

The more traditional blues tracks aren’t forgotten the likes of ‘Need It Awful Bad’ and ‘Luv A Dog’.  But it’s the likes of ‘Rock ‘n’ Roll Man, ‘In The Land Of Rock ‘n’ Roll’, and the down right brilliant 'Motor Cycle Blues’ that make this album one of the best guitar player albums I’ve heard for a while.
